"Say a sat a post/reply or something"... It's technically possible 😏 But also not possible until all clients show messages received from relays. For now, what I've implemented in Nosflare is it hashes every note sent to it. And this can be fine-tuned down to the hash of a single word. So, for example, as I've done with the wss://relay.nosflare.com relay it only allows the same thing once. If someone else writes a note that just says "GM" they'll be the only ones who can publish a note with just "GM" that day. But as this is configurable, it can help at least stop spam that blasts the same thing over and over again. Of course, it can be evaded should they iterate those notes incrementally with something that makes the content unique each time. In my mind, it's the best compromise for now, that doesn't rely on WoT, and won't effectively excommunicate interactions from new peeps on Nostr.

WoT can be in the client or it can also be on a relay. Like my relay nostr.mom uses WoT for comparing reports of users with their trust score in order to slow down a user or not. To check whether reports are authentic or whether there are enough reports that are enough to slow down a user. WoT can be also useful for determining whether a fresh user has enough score to be able to tag many people, add a lot of images, send a lot of links or not just in the beginning of his adventure.

My relays actually require PoW sometimes. I guess I am the first users of dynamic PoW. Based on how much a user spams my scripts sometimes require more PoW before dropping the user altogheter. So these requirements act like a warning if the user happens to listen to relay responses.

I think some relays will get better at handling spam and thats a good thing. A gradient of options is good for nostr users.
